ザ・グラフ(GRT)関連APIの使い方動画まとめ



ザ・グラフ(GRT)関連APIの使い方動画まとめ


ザ・グラフ(GRT)関連APIの使い方動画まとめ

ザ・グラフ(GRT)は、ブロックチェーン上のデータを効率的にクエリするためのプロトコルであり、分散型アプリケーション(dApps)の開発において不可欠なツールとなっています。GRTを利用することで、ブロックチェーンの複雑なデータを容易にアクセスし、活用することが可能になります。本記事では、GRT関連APIの使い方を解説する動画をまとめ、開発者がGRTをより深く理解し、効果的に活用するための情報を提供します。

1. GRT APIの基礎知識

GRT APIは、GraphQLをベースとしたクエリ言語を使用します。GraphQLは、クライアントが必要なデータのみを要求できるため、効率的なデータ取得が可能です。GRT APIを利用する上で、GraphQLの基本的な知識を理解しておくことが重要です。GraphQLの概念、クエリの構文、スキーマの理解などが含まれます。GRT APIは、Subgraphsと呼ばれるデータソースを介してブロックチェーン上のデータにアクセスします。Subgraphsは、特定のブロックチェーンイベントやエンティティを監視し、GraphQL APIを通じてアクセス可能な形式に変換します。

2. 開発環境の構築

GRT APIを利用するための開発環境を構築するには、以下の手順が必要です。

  • Node.jsとnpmのインストール
  • GraphQLクライアントライブラリのインストール(例:Apollo Client, Relay)
  • GRT APIのエンドポイントの取得
  • Subgraphsのデプロイ(必要に応じて)

これらの手順を完了することで、GRT APIを利用するための準備が整います。開発環境の構築に関する詳細な情報は、GRTの公式ドキュメントを参照してください。

3. API利用動画の紹介

3.1. GRT API入門

この動画では、GRT APIの基本的な使い方を解説しています。GraphQLの基礎から、GRT APIのエンドポイントへの接続、簡単なクエリの実行方法まで、初心者向けのコンテンツとなっています。具体的な例を交えながら、GRT APIの利用方法をステップバイステップで解説しています。

3.2. Subgraphsの作成とデプロイ

この動画では、Subgraphsの作成からデプロイまでの手順を解説しています。Subgraphsは、GRT APIを通じてブロックチェーン上のデータにアクセスするための重要な要素です。動画では、Subgraphsの定義、マッピングファイルの作成、ローカル環境でのテスト、そしてメインネットへのデプロイまで、一連の流れを丁寧に解説しています。

3.3. 複雑なクエリの実行

この動画では、より複雑なクエリの実行方法を解説しています。複数のエンティティを結合したり、フィルタリングやソートを行ったりするなど、高度なクエリの書き方を学ぶことができます。動画では、具体的なユースケースを想定し、実践的なクエリの例を紹介しています。

3.4. エラーハンドリングとデバッグ

この動画では、GRT APIを利用する際に発生する可能性のあるエラーとその対処方法を解説しています。エラーメッセージの解釈、デバッグツールの利用、そしてエラーを回避するためのベストプラクティスなどを学ぶことができます。動画では、一般的なエラーの例を挙げ、具体的な解決策を提示しています。

4. GRT APIの応用例

GRT APIは、様々なdAppsの開発に活用できます。以下に、いくつかの応用例を紹介します。

  • DeFiアプリケーション: 貸付、借入、取引などのDeFiアプリケーションにおいて、トークンの残高、流動性プールの情報、取引履歴などを取得するためにGRT APIを利用できます。
  • NFTマーケットプレイス: NFTの所有者、取引履歴、メタデータなどを取得するためにGRT APIを利用できます。
  • ゲーム: ゲーム内のアイテム、キャラクター、ランキングなどを取得するためにGRT APIを利用できます。
  • 分析ツール: ブロックチェーン上のデータを分析し、トレンドやパターンを把握するためにGRT APIを利用できます。

5. 注意点とベストプラクティス

GRT APIを利用する際には、以下の点に注意する必要があります。

  • APIレート制限: GRT APIにはレート制限が設けられています。レート制限を超過すると、APIへのアクセスが制限される可能性があります。
  • データ整合性: ブロックチェーン上のデータは変更される可能性があります。GRT APIを利用する際には、データの整合性を確認する必要があります。
  • セキュリティ: GRT APIを利用する際には、セキュリティに十分注意する必要があります。APIキーの漏洩や不正アクセスを防ぐための対策を講じる必要があります。

GRT APIを効果的に活用するためのベストプラクティスとしては、以下の点が挙げられます。

  • キャッシュの利用: 頻繁にアクセスするデータはキャッシュに保存することで、APIへの負荷を軽減できます。
  • クエリの最適化: 効率的なクエリを作成することで、APIの応答時間を短縮できます。
  • エラーハンドリング: エラーが発生した場合に備えて、適切なエラーハンドリング処理を実装する必要があります。

6. まとめ

本記事では、ザ・グラフ(GRT)関連APIの使い方を解説する動画をまとめ、GRT APIの基礎知識、開発環境の構築、API利用動画の紹介、応用例、注意点とベストプラクティスについて解説しました。GRT APIは、ブロックチェーン上のデータを効率的にクエリするための強力なツールであり、dAppsの開発において不可欠な存在です。本記事で紹介した情報を参考に、GRT APIを効果的に活用し、革新的なdAppsの開発に貢献してください。GRT APIに関する情報は常に更新されていますので、最新のドキュメントや情報を参照するように心がけてください。継続的な学習と実践を通じて、GRT APIのスキルを向上させ、より高度なアプリケーションの開発に挑戦してください。


前の記事

ビットバンクで仮想通貨の価格予測に役立つニュースまとめ

次の記事

bitbank(ビットバンク)で仮想通貨ウォレットを管理する際のポイント

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です